Mysql declare syntax error missing semicolon

if the Delimiter doesn' t do the trick maybe its an error in your syntax because you didn' t SET your SELECT query in a variable. System variables and user- defined variables can be used in stored programs,. “ Local Variable DECLARE Syntax. 7, this results in a syntax CLARE usuario VARCHAR. “ Syntax error: missing ' semicolon' ” em procedure do MySQL. Faça uma pergunta. Error MySQL syntax. You need to change your default delimiter to something else than ;. Otherwise your definition ends at the first ; which would make it incomplete. delimiter | CREATE TRIGGER trg_ InsertProductWatchListPriceHistory AFTER. Transact- SQL Syntax Conventions.

  • Windows 10 defender service error 577
  • Ошибка 720 при подключении
  • Error 9006 itunes on mac
  • Error 500 java null pointer exception
  • Windows error please select boot device

  • Video:Error mysql semicolon

    Mysql declare error

    Transact- SQL statement terminator. Although the semicolon is not required for most. if the object cannot be found, an error is. ini Semicolon Delimited. at end of SQL statement. 3138 Syntax error in 3208 Invalid Deleted. zypper install php5 php5- posix php5- mysql php5- pcntl. This is a general- purpose syntax error and is often caused by: A missing semicolon ( ; ). Another common cause of this error is forgetting to declare a. · An Introduction to Stored Procedures in MySQL 5. the delimiter has always been a semicolon. Declare a variable using the following syntax: DECLARE. Estoy haciendo una consulta y me aparece el siguiente error: syntax error missing ' semicolon' Aca les dejo la consulta :.

    DECLARE syntax- error en MySQL. I am trying to convert an Oracle database to MySQL. MySQL Syntax Error 1064 On Set. This gives me an error of 1064 Syntax Error: Missing semicolon. What is a syntax error? understand and identify syntax and logic errors. a missing semicolon at the end of a line or an extra bracket at the end of a. check the manual that corresponds to your MySQL server version for the right syntax to use near ' DECLARE val1. to MySQL - Syntax Error. Where is the error in my syntax? mysql stored- procedures.

    You' re missing a GIN DECLARE haveAllVariables INT;. I think the problem is : you are not using DELIMITER. So just put it this way: DELIMITER / / create procedure AddColumnUnlessExists( IN dbName tinytext, IN tableName tinytext, IN fieldName tinytext, IN fieldDef text) begin IF. Can' t declare variable inside PROCEDURE: Submitted:. ( 20) " workbench reports a syntax error: missing semi. I get the error - DECLARE ' declare' is not a valid. When the cursor is no longer used, you should close it. When working with MySQL cursor, you must also declare a NOT FOUND handler to handle the situation when the. I' m a nubie so it could be something simple that I' m missing. right syntax to use near ' DECLARE INT SET Problem declaring variables in MySQL. the mysql client will treat the first semicolon, at the end of the DECLARE x. the default semicolon. The \ g and \ G delimiters can. · There is a semicolon ( ; ) missing. Carefully check the syntax when this error is thrown.

    / / SyntaxError missing ; before statement var array. But when I try to test that syntax on MySQL ( not JDBC yet), it prompts me to the next line as if it was missing a semicolon ( ; ),. it throws a syntax error. Local Variable DECLARE Syntax. 5 Reference Manual /. Each IF must be terminated by its own END IF followed by a semicolon. MySQL存储过程开发编译心得. 我的开发平台是workbench, 是mysql自己的客户端, 英文界面。 DECLARE报错, 提示: Syntax error: missing. You are missing custom delimiter instruction. As you missed it, engine tried to compile the statements when it found the first default statement terminator, the semicolon ;. And hence the exception.

    Place your entire routine in. Mysql Stored procedure to insert into database table, missing semi colon error · mysql stored- procedures semicolon. i was creating this stored procedure in mysql for the first time and i stumbled upon this " semi colon missing" error and i' m. The only important variable missing is the row count of. Firebird requires that every statement end in a semicolon ;. / * MS SQL syntax. * / DECLARE my_ cursor. An Introduction to Stored Procedures in MySQL 5. Declare a variable using the following syntax: DECLARE varname DATA. Tenho a procedure abaixo CREATE PROCEDURE ` SP_ notasAluno` ( IN aluno INT) BEGIN DECLARE ditCodigo, courseId INT; DECLARE usuario VARCHAR( 50. MySQL Functions SQL Server Functions MS Access Functions Oracle Functions SQL Operators SQL Data Types SQL Quick Ref. SQL Syntax Previous Next.

    Try like this: DROP procedure IF exists getQueueMessage; DELIMITER $ $ CREATE PROCEDURE ` getQueueMessage` ( msg varcharBEGIN SELECT ` Name` FROM queues WHERE Id IN. The DELIMITER command is used to change the standard delimiter of MySQL. we get the syntax error. < br / > READS SQL DATA< br / > BEGIN< br / > DECLARE v. Transact- SQL Syntax. PRINT N' Rolling back the transaction two times would cause an error. - - Uses AdventureWorks DECLARE Integer = 0. In the MySQL command line client, one can use the delimiter command: delimiter ; ; CREATE. Make sure you set the delimiter to something other than semicolon before you declare your function: DELIMITER | CREATE. 7 Reference Manual. Error Codes, and Common Problems. Compound- Statement Syntax / DECLARE Syntax 13. 3 DECLARE Syntax. The DECLARE statement is used.

    MySQL Workbench sends the code as- is to the server. MySQL uses ; as a statement delimiter. When it encounters ; on line 3 it thinks the statement that started with CREATE PROCEDURE ends and it is followed by many other. 172kI got an error of " Syntax error ( missing. / oledbexception- missing- semicolon- at- end. is throwing an error; mysql. This article explains terminating SQL statements with semicolons,. result in a T- SQL syntax error:. with a semicolon to prevent syntax mistakes in. MySQL Missing Colon. this in MySQL and I tried to use it but I can' t get it to work in mySQL because it always says " Syntax Error;. Begin Declare vFamilia. If a DECLARE CURSOR using Transact- SQL syntax does not specify READ_ ONLY, OPTIMISTIC, or SCROLL_ LOCKS, the default is as follows:. Thanks for the question about your MySQL syntax code error.